/* ¡á PC È¸¿ø°ü·Ã CSS ##################################################### */
/*---------------------------------------------------------- 
     È¸¿ø°ü·Ã
------------------------------------------------------------*/

.mem_basic_div_box{text-align:left; font-size:12px; padding:12px 3px 25px 3px; overflow:hidden;}
.mem_basic_mob_div_box{text-align:left; font-size:12px; padding:25px 12px 0px 12px; overflow:hidden;}
.mob_basic_insert_cate_div{font-size:12px; padding-bottom:25px; border-bottom:0px solid #000000;}
.mob_basic_insert_cate_div dl{font-size:18px; color:#000000; padding-top:0px; font-weight:bold;}
.mob_basic_insert_cate_div dd{color:#979797; font-size:12px; margin:12px 0 6px 0;}
.mob_basic_insert_cate_div dd span{color:#979797; font-size:12px;}
.mem_basic_div_cate{margin-bottom:25px; text-align:left; overflow:hidden;}
.mem_basic_ul_cate{padding:0; margin:0; list-style:none;}
.mem_basic_li_span_cate{color:#555555;}
.mem_basic_li_span_black{color:#000000;}
.mem_basic_cate_img{margin-bottom:3px;}
.mem_basic_li_left_cate{font-weight:bold; font-size:24px; margin:0; padding:0; display:inline; float:left;}
.mem_basic_li_right_cate{color:#a6a6a6; margin:7px 0 0 0; padding:0; display:inline; float:right;}
.mem_basic_lose_span_font{color:#999999;}
.mem_basic_form_div_line{border:1px solid #dadada; padding:40px 0 40px 0; text-align:center; overflow:hidden;}
.mem_basic_form_td_left{width:130px; height:40px; text-align:left; font-size:14px; font-weight:bold; line-height:28px; padding-left:3px;}
.mem_basic_form_td_right{font-size:12px; line-height:28px; padding-left:7px;}
.mem_basic_form_input{width:98%; color:#464646; height:28px; line-height:28px; font-size:14px; border:1px solid #e7e7e7; padding-top:0px; vertical-align:center;}
.mem_basic_form_input_box{width:95px; color:#464646; height:28px; line-height:28px; font-size:14px; border:1px solid #e7e7e7; padding-top:0px; vertical-align:center;}
.mem_basic_button_reg_link{width:110px; line-height:2.8; text-align:center; border:1px solid #343434; background-color:#434343; display:inline-block;}
.mem_basic_button_reg_font{color:#ffffff; font-size:14px; font-weight:bold;}
.mem_basic_button_re_link{width:110px; line-height:2.8; text-align:center; border:1px solid #827f86; background-color:#898492; display:inline-block;}
.mem_basic_button_re_font{color:#ffffff; font-size:14px; font-weight:bold;}
.mem_basic_login_div_box{width:460px; margin:0 auto; overflow:hidden;}
.mem_basic_login_button{width:96px; height:71px; color:#ffffff; font-size:14px; vertical-align:center; text-align:center; font-weight:bold; line-height:40px; cursor:pointer; background-color:#333333;}
.mem_basic_span_text{font-size:12px; font-weight:bold;}
.mem_basic_button_left{padding-left:9px;}
.mem_basic_check_td{line-height:28px; text-align:left; padding-left:140px;}
.mem_basic_text_td{padding-top:40px; text-align:left;}
.mem_basic_dae_text{font-size:14px; font-weight:bold;}
.mem_basic_so_text{line-height:28px;}
.mem_basic_button_td{width:130px; text-align:center;}
.mem_basic_div_text{width:100%; text-align:left; margin-bottom:10px; overflow:hidden;}
.mem_basic_span_text{font-size:14px; font-weight:bold;}
.mem_basic_table_div{width:100%; overflow:hidden;}
.mem_basic_td_line{height:2px; background-color:#474747;}
.mem_basic_td_left{width:130px; font-size:12px; line-height:26px; height:0px; padding-left:3px;}
.mem_basic_td_right{padding-left:8px; font-size:12px; line-height:26px; padding-top:5px; padding-bottom:5px;}
.mem_basic_td_right_file{padding-left:8px; line-height:20px; padding-top:6px; padding-bottom:0px;}
.mem_basic_td_secret{width:60px;}
.mem_basic_button_div{width:100%; text-align:center; padding:20px 0 0px 0; overflow:hidden;}
.mem_basic_photo_img{width:48px; cursor:pointer;}
.mem_basic_lose_div_box{width:460px; margin:0 auto; overflow:hidden;}
.mem_basic_lose_div_text{line-height:2.0; text-align:left; padding:0px 0 20px 0; border-bottom:1px solid #dadada; overflow:hidden;}
.mem_basic_lose_span_font{color:#999999;}
.mem_basic_lose_div_table{margin:20px 0 20px 0; text-align:left; overflow:hidden;}
.mem_basic_lose_div_button{text-align:center; overflow:hidden;}
.mem_basic_lose_button{width:300px; color:#ffffff; font-size:14px; vertical-align:center; text-align:center; font-weight:bold; line-height:40px; cursor:pointer; background-color:#333333;}
.mem_basic_agree_textbox{height:200px; padding:20px; overflow:auto; margin-bottom:30px; border:1px solid #e7e7e7;
		scrollbar-face-color:#cdcdcd; scrollbar-highlight-color:#f0f0f0; scrollbar-3dlight-color:#f0f0f0; scrollbar-shadow-color:#f0f0f0;
		scrollbar-darkshadow-color:#f0f0f0; scrollbar-track-color:#f0f0f0; scrollbar-arrow-color:#606060;}
.mem_basic_agree_dl{}
.mem_basic_agree_dt{font-size:14px; font-weight:bold; color:#343434; margin-bottom:7px;}
.mem_basic_agree_dd{margin-bottom:10px; font-size:12px; line-height:1.7; text-align:justify;}
.mem_basic_agree_bt_div{text-align:center;}
.mem_basic_button_ok{width:110px; height:41px; color:#ffffff; font-size:14px; vertical-align:center; text-align:center; font-weight:bold; line-height:41px; cursor:pointer; background-color:#434343;}
.mem_basic_button_cancel{width:110px; height:41px; color:#ffffff; font-size:14px; vertical-align:center; text-align:center; font-weight:bold; line-height:41px; cursor:pointer; background-color:#898492;}
.mem_basic_text_input{color:#464646; height:24px; line-height:24px; font-size:12px; border:1px solid #e7e7e7; padding-top:0px; vertical-align:center;}
.mem_basic_text_textarea{width:99.4%; height:60px; color:#464646; line-height:24px; font-size:12px; border:1px solid #e7e7e7; resize:none;}
.mem_basic_text_span_bold{font-weight:bold;}
.mem_basic_text_span_num{color:#f22800;}
.mem_basic_text_span_secure{color:#f22800; font-weight:bold;}
.mem_basic_button_point{cursor:pointer;}
.mem_basic_display{width:100%; display:none;}
.mem_basic_button_div{width:100%; text-align:center; padding:20px 0 0px 0; overflow:hidden;}
.mem_basic_iframe_div{width:100%; height:1px; display:none; overflow:hidden;}
.mem_basic_order_div_line{border:0px solid #dadada; margin-top:45px; padding:40px 0 40px 0; text-align:center; overflow:hidden;}
.mem_basic_order_info{padding:10px 3px 7px 3px; line-height:20px; margin-top:7px; border-top:1px solid #dadada; border-bottom:1px solid #dadada;}
.mem_basic_order_fontbold{font-weight:bold;}
.mem_basic_order_select{margin-top:14px; margin-bottom:4px;}
.mem_basic_order_black_line{border-top:2px solid #474747; overflow:hidden;}
.mem_basic_order_ti_td{font-size:12px; font-weight:bold; line-height:32px; text-align:center; background-color:#efefef;}
.mem_basic_order_su_td{line-height:34px; font-size:12px; text-align:center;}
.mem_basic_order_td_line{height:1px; background-color:#dadada;}
.mem_basic_order_dpy_div{padding:10px 5px 5px 5px; font-size:12px; border-bottom:1px solid #dadada; line-height:22px; text-align:left;}
.mem_basic_order_dpy_info{border-top:2px dotted #c5c5c5; line-height:22px; margin-top:5px; padding-top:10px;}
.mem_basic_order_dpy_dae{font-weight:bold; font-size:14px;}
.mem_basic_order_dpy_span{color:#c80303; font-size:12px;}
.mem_basic_order_form{border-bottom:1px solid #dadada; background-color:#eeeeee; padding:5px 7px 5px 7px; margin:0px 0 10px 0;}
.mem_basic_order_input{color:#464646; height:24px; line-height:24px; font-size:12px; border:1px solid #e7e7e7; padding-top:0px; vertical-align:center;}
.mem_basic_order_button{width:90px; padding:4px 0px 4px 0px; color:#ffffff; border:0px solid #dadada; font-size:12px; vertical-align:center; text-align:center; font-weight:bold; line-height:27px; cursor:pointer; background-color:#333333;}
.mem_basic_order_div_point{text-align:right; font-weight:bold; padding:0px 7px 7px 7px; margin:10px 0 10px 0; border-bottom:1px solid #dadada;}
.mem_basic_order_span_point{font-size:16px; color:#0063b0;}
.mem_basic_order_div_page{text-align:center; margin-top:30px; margin-bottom:16px;}
.mem_basic_order_font_black{color:#000000;}
.mem_basic_order_font_red{color:#c80303;}
.mem_basic_order_font_blue{color:#0063b0;}
.mem_basic_order_font_green{color:#40c002; font-weight:bold;}
.mem_basic_order_font_gray{color:#767676;}
.mem_basic_order_font_16px{font-weight:bold; font-size:16px;}
.mem_basic_order_bodytextarea{margin-top:6px; margin-bottom:6px; resize:none; height:106px; font-size:12px; overflow:hidden; background-color:#B9EFFF; border:1px solid #88E1FA; line-height:100%;}
.mem_basic_order_cell_box{padding:0px 7px 0px 7px;}
.mem_basic_order_cell_div{padding-top:7px; padding-left:3px;}
.mem_basic_order_cell_close{text-align:right; padding-top:14px;}
.mem_basic_order_input_scrap{color:#464646; height:24px; line-height:24px; text-align:center; font-size:12px; border:1px solid #e7e7e7; margin:3px 3px 3px 3px; padding-top:0px; vertical-align:center;}
.mem_basic_order_form_scrap{border-bottom:1px solid #dadada; background-color:#eeeeee; padding:5px 7px 5px 7px;}
.mem_basic_order_info_scrap{padding:10px 3px 7px 3px; line-height:20px; margin-top:0px; border-bottom:1px solid #dadada;}
.mem_basic_order_num_scrap{color:#c80303; font-size:8pt; font-family:Tahoma,µ¸¿ò; font-weight:bold;}
.mem_basic_order_td_scrap{width:120px; text-align:center;}
.mem_basic_order_subject_scrap{line-height:34px; padding:0px 7px 0px 7px; text-align:left;}
.mem_basic_order_link{cursor:pointer;}
.mem_basic_order_center{text-align:center;}
.mem_basic_order_end_div{text-align:center; margin:20px 20px 20px 20px; padding:50px 0 50px 0; line-height:24px;}
.page_number{color:#000000; font-size:12px; border:1px solid #d7d5d5; background-color:#ffffff; padding:6px 10px 6px 10px; margin:3px; font-family:Arial, Helvetica, sans-serif; font-weight:bold;}

/* ¡á ¸ð¹ÙÀÏ - È¸¿ø°¡ÀÔ ##################################################### */
.selects_box select{height:27px; border:1px #dadada solid; font-size:12px; padding:0 0px 0 0px; line-height:27px; cursor:pointer;}
.mob_skin_insert_div_box{padding:0px 12px 0px 12px; font-family:µ¸¿ò; text-align:left; background-color:#ffffff;}
.mob_skin_insert_cate_div{font-size:12px; border-bottom:2px solid #000000;}
.mob_skin_insert_cate_div dl{font-size:18px; color:#000000; padding-top:0px; font-weight:bold;}
.mob_skin_insert_cate_div dd{color:#979797; font-size:12px; margin:12px 0 6px 0;}
.mob_skin_insert_cate_div dd span{color:#979797; font-size:12px;}
.mob_skin_mem_agree_div{text-align:left; font-size:12px; padding:15px 0 15px 0;}
.mob_skin_mem_agree_btn_div{text-align:right; overflow:hidden;}
.mob_skin_mem_agree_btn_box{width:80px; font-family:µ¸¿ò; padding:4px 0 4px 0; border:1px solid #757575; background-color:#888888; font-size:11px; color:#ffffff; cursor:pointer;}
.mob_skin_mem_agree_text_div{font-size:12px; color:#000000; overflow:hidden; font-family:µ¸¿ò; line-height:1.6; margin-top:5px; border:1px solid #dadada; padding:5px;}
.mob_skin_mem_agree_text_div dl{padding:0; margin:0; list-style:none;}
.mob_skin_mem_agree_text_div dt{padding:0; margin:0; list-style:none;}
.mob_skin_mem_agree_text_div dd{padding:0; margin:0; list-style:none;}
.mob_skin_mem_agree_check_div{margin-top:3px; line-height:1.4; overflow:hidden;}
.mob_skin_mem_agree_reg_div{margin-top:20px; text-align:center; overflow:hidden;}
.mob_skin_mem_agree_btn_reg{width:100px; font-family:µ¸¿ò; padding:9px 0 9px 0; text-align:center; border:1px solid #262626; background-color:#343434; font-weight:bold; font-size:14px; color:#ffffff;}
.mob_skin_mem_reg_info{border-bottom:1px solid #dadada; padding:10px 0px 10px 0px; font-size:12px; overflow:hidden;}
.mob_skin_mem_reg_left{width:100px; color:#444444; line-height:1.6; padding:9px 7px 9px 7px; font-weight:bold; font-size:12px; background-color:#f5f5f5;}
.mob_skin_mem_reg_right{font-size:12px; line-height:1.6; padding:5px 7px 5px 7px;}
.mob_skin_mem_reg_secret{width:13px; line-height:1.6; text-align:right; padding:0px 3px 0px 0px;}
.mob_skin_mem_reg_line{height:1px; background-color:#dadada;}
.mob_skin_mem_reg_input{height:26px;font-size:12px; border:1px solid #dadada;}
.mob_skin_mem_reg_long_input{width:100%; height:26px; font-size:12px; border:1px solid #dadada;}
.mob_skin_mem_reg_size_input{width:86px; height:26px; font-size:12px; border:1px solid #dadada;}
.mob_skin_mem_reg_joso_input{width:100%; height:26px; font-size:12px; margin-top:4px; border:1px solid #dadada;}
.mob_skin_mem_reg_ph_input{width:40px; height:26px; font-size:12px; border:1px solid #dadada;}
.mob_skin_mem_reg_text_input{width:100%; font-size:12px; border:1px solid #dadada; resize:none;}
.mob_skin_mem_reg_so_link{width:60px; padding:3px 0px 2px 0px; text-align:center; background-color:#b7b4be; border:1px solid #a4a0a9; display:inline-block;}
.mob_skin_mem_reg_so_font{color:#ffffff;}
.mob_skin_mem_reg_span_font{color:#5a5a5a; font-size:11px;}
.mob_skin_mem_reg_svdiv{margin:20px 0 25px 0; text-align:center; overflow:hidden;}
.mob_skin_mem_reg_svlink{width:100px; font-family:µ¸¿ò; padding:9px 0 9px 0; text-align:center; border:1px solid #262626; background-color:#343434; display:inline-block;}
.mob_skin_mem_reg_svfont{font-weight:bold; font-size:14px; color:#ffffff;}
.mob_skin_mem_reg_none{display:none;}
.checkbox_lock{display:none;} /* ºñ°ø°³ Ã¼Å©¹Ú½º */
.sec_lock_imgs{cursor:pointer; width:12px; height:12px;} /* ºñ°ø°³ ¾ÆÀÌÄÜ */


